“鬼魅般的超距作用。”愛因斯坦曾這樣描述量子力學的一個關鍵原則:糾纏。
當兩個粒子呈現糾纏狀態時,即使這兩個粒子中間橫亙著整個銀河系,它們之間的相關屬性也是彼此關聯的。想一想《星際迷航》中的蟲洞,能將原子傳送到非常遙遠的地方。量子力學還會產生其他“鬼魅”般的事物:量子隧道效應使得粒子可以穿過致密的墻體;另外還具有一個神秘的屬性:疊加態,該屬性使得它們可以同時處于兩種狀態,我們可以為這兩種狀態分別賦值0和1。
這些看起來都很瘋狂,但目前這些情況都僅僅發生在原子尺度上;在這個尺度上,物理定律是不一樣的。愛因斯坦就非常懷疑量子糾纏現象的存在,1935年他還就此問題寫了一篇論文《物理現實的量子力學描述能否認為是完備的》,他認為量子糾纏不可能存在。
在這個問題上,愛因斯坦錯了。研究人員現在已經能在15英里(約24.1千米)的長度上獲得糾纏態的量子信息。他們正在利用量子力學的力量獲得實質性的進展。
當然,有一點愛因斯坦卻是正確的,這的確很“鬼魅”。
現在,量子學已經被用來建造新一代的計算機,人們相信這種計算機能夠解決許多復雜的科學問題—并且解碼世界上所有的密鑰。它們幾秒鐘的計算所產生的結果需要傳統計算機上百萬年的時間才能完成。它們能提供更好的天氣預測、金融分析、后勤策劃、尋找類地行星和尋找合適的藥物。當然,它們也能破解世界上每一個銀行賬戶、私人通信和世界上每一臺電腦上的密碼—因為現代的加密技術建立在大量字符的大型組合編碼數據上,量子計算機只需要借助自己的超高運算速度進行窮舉破譯即可。
現在,制作量子計算機的大賽已經拉開。進軍這一領域包含了IBM、Google和微軟等科技巨頭,另外還有國防合同承包上和大學研究機構。一家加拿大的初創公司聲稱已經成功開發出第一款量子計算機。荷蘭代爾夫特理工大學的物理學家Ronald Hanson也曾告訴《科學美國人》說他將在5年內制造出量子計算機的構造模塊,并且在10年內制造出全功能的演示機。
量子計算機的出現將會改變商業和網絡戰的平衡。這些問題都和國家安全密切相關,就像是核武器一樣。
使一個通用量子計算機在短短五年的構建模塊和一個全功能的演示機在一個小十數年。
這將改變權力在商業和網絡戰的平衡。他們有深厚的國家安全問題,因為他們的技術當量核武器。
首先讓我們解釋一下量子計算機是什么,我們現在又走到哪一步了。
在傳統的計算機中,信息由比特位、二進制數字表示,每個位的值要么是0、要么是1.因為位只有這兩個取值,長序列的0和1可以組成數字和進行計算。而量子計算機使用的是量子位,量子位能夠同時取值0和1—以“0+1”表示疊加態。量子計算機的計算性能隨量子位的增加指數級增長。量子計算機工作時并不是傳統計算機那樣按照順序進行計算,而是通過列出所有的可能并測量結果來解決問題。
想象一下能夠在同一時間使用各種可能的順序組合來對密碼進行驗證。盡管這個比喻并不完美,因為量子計算中的結果測量是比較復雜的,但這也能大概描述相關的思路。
制造量子計算機有很多復雜的問題需要解決。首先需要找到能夠產生糾纏光子對的合適材料;然后還有還要設計出合適的邏輯門并將其制造在計算機芯片上;量子位的生成和控制;存儲機制的設計以及錯誤識別。但是幾乎每個月我們都能看到新的突破出現。比如說IBM就剛宣布發現了一種探測和測量量子計算中的錯誤的新方法,并且設計了一種新的量子電路;如果這種電路的數量足夠,就能構建出量子計算機芯片所需要的大芯片。
大部分研究者都認為量子計算機的出現只是時間問題—量子計算機終將進入實用階段。但具體的時間人們的分歧較大,有人認為5年,有人認為還需要20年。今年4月份,IBM說我們已經進入了一個量子計算研究的黃金時代并且自信地宣稱他們自己會首先制造出可用的量子計算機。
D-Wave的量子計算機
加拿大初創公司D-Wave則宣稱他們已經成功研制出量子計算機,該公司CEO Vern Brownell在郵件中說道,D-Wave系統已經制造出第一臺可擴展的量子計算機,其中應用了可驗證的糾纏機制,現在已經可以在日漸復雜的問題上得到最佳結果。為了讓人們相信他們的研究結果,他們強調了他們的方法,這種方法稱為“絕熱計算”,現在這種方法還不能解決所有的問題,但在計算的優化、采樣、機器學習和一些商業、國防和科研領域上可能會有廣泛的應用。他說D-Wave和數字計算機是互補的;是一種為特定類型的問題設計的專用目的的計算機資源。
D-Wave 2計算機擁有512個量子位,理論上可以同時執行2^512項操作。這比宇宙中的原子數還多幾個數量級。Brownell說該公司很快就將發布超過1000個量子位的處理器。他說他的計算機并不會運行Shor算法(一種用于加密的必要算法),但其有在圖像檢測、物流、蛋白質映射和折疊等方面的潛在應用價值,以及在蒙特卡洛模擬與金融建模、石油勘探和尋求外星球上也有使用意義。
所以量子計算機事實上已經存在了,至少是某種形式的量子計算機;但全功能的量子計算機還并沒出現。當量子計算機變得主流、成為我們個人計算機、大型機和智能手機上的主要計算方式時,人類的命運將迎來巨大的變革。
但是和所有的先進技術一樣,量子計算機也能帶來噩夢。其中最值得擔憂的就是加密。開發新的保護數據的方法并不容易。目前常用的RSA公鑰加密算法就使用了5年時間才成功開發出來。公開密鑰加密算法的先驅Ralph Merkle指出公共密鑰系統的技術的更新至少需要十年時間。另外還有一個實施的過程,這樣才能保護全球的計算機和信息。如果沒有什么緊急推廣或快捷的方式,要取代現有的安全加密手段至少需要20年時間。
我們已經為即將到來的“鬼魅”般的計算機技術做好準備。